"The Maxfield Rabbit's release Evermore is an intimate portrait of relationship pain wrapped in a perfectly recorded and written pop/rock format - with female vocals that cut through like a skewer through plastic wrap - with hints of Allanis and a pure sweet sound that departs from the angst on a path forged with originality by singer/songwriter, Julia Albert. The rhythm section, including guitar - is pure rock and roll ala Stones/Crows - with tasty mildly distorted LesPaul sounding axes and laid back just-behind-the beat 2 and 4. The bass is like a rock - supporting with occasional melodic runs that land deep in the pocket. Acoustic tracks are speckled throughout. Track 10, It's All Right By Me, is a slow groover with a Leaving Las Vegas message of acceptance that rings true and with a huge sense of love relief, 'I don't want to own you, I shouldn't have to own you, to keep every moment sweet, and I don't want to change you, cuz anyway I'd make you isn't what you would be'. The final track, I Fail the Words, is an intelligent and insightful revelation of what clogs most relationship drains, as the heroine tries to find the right words to comfort her partner, 'you hurt my feelings and God I still need you, I fake the truth to comfort me, I can't seem to choose, I fail the words to comfort you, I can't seem to choose a side.' The tune also includes a cool wah-wah motif of a guitar line - that ads a certain musical class to the mix. The highlight of the CD is the fourth track, a duet called "Drunk". The male and female vocals speak to each other with sentiment that mixes alcohol with marriage proposals - all with an origin that the two need each other through the sorrow they've shared and bring to the table, 'you keep coming back to this fate of mine. . you're right when you're mine, why don't you want me, please don't go, you need my sorrow. .i can't find happy.' Great melody and haunting dysfunction/love mix. This is a touching and insanely accurate record in its reflection on relationships - great musicianship and sincerity, maturity and unpretentious delivery - expertly recorded with subtle Maxfield Rabbit class. earBuzz.com --This text refers to the Audio CD edition.

Sophomore album by this New Zealand Alternative Pop/Rock trio of brothers, who have won numerous NZ and Australian music awards since the release of their debut album, Dreams. Although not as atmospheric as their debut, the songs here have much more depth to them. Warner. 2006.Album Details
The Three Hume Brothers of Evermore have Come a Long Way Since the Release of their Debut Album Dreams. It's a Far Cry from their Humble and Rain-drenched Beginnings in Rural New Zealand, and it all Culminates in their New Album, Real Life. The Writing and Initial Recording of "Real Life" Took Place in the Isolation of their Central Coast Abode, an Isolation the Boys were Not Only Used To, but Actively Encouraged. Separating Into Different Rooms, They Each Had their Own Private Recording Studio in Miniature, Working on Tracks Solo Before Bringing them Together for the Evermore Polish. Respected Engineer John Alagia (Who Mixed Dreams, and Has Worked with Acts Like John Mayer, Dave Matthews Band and Ben Folds) was Chosen for the Job for his Twiddling Tenacity and his Striking Good Looks. But Perhaps the Main Difference Between the Two Albums is in the Songs Themselves.Customer Reviews:

Real Life opens with a powerful and positive title tune, which might be about waking up from one's Dreams and "stepping into the light" of one's adult Real Life. It segues into the hit single Running - an anthemic, confident rock song with a memorable chorus. This song received tons of airplay on Australian radio in 2006, making it one of the year's best known pop hits. Current single Light Surrounding You is a melodic winner that has gone even further up the chart and is sitting this week at #1 on the Australian singles chart. My favourite song on here is the fantastic The Great Unknown. The guitar sound on this track is reminiscent of U2, and, honestly , this is one of the best songs I heard in years, and I played this track heaps of times in August 2006 after buying my copy of the CD. Some slower songs like Afloat are balanced by loud , guitar based rock like Unbreakable and fine songs like My Guiding Light, and there are some melancholy moments too. Overall though, this album is catchier even than Evermore's 2004 debut CD Dreams, and a little more optimistic and "mainstream" in tone.

The line between evangelist and entertainer has always been somewhat indistinct. But as showcased on this 43-track, double-disc collection culled from his '87-'96 recordings for Elektra/Nonesuch/Atlantic, Michael Feinstein's dedication to spreading the gospel of the American song often blurs it beyond recognition. While the singer's pedigree for the task is impeccable (a long-term stint as Ira Gershwin's assistant and early career sponsorship by Liza Minnelli), his interpretations often succeed by playing off a tense axis of fervent emotionalism and a joyous sense of irreverence.If his readings of romantic standards can sometimes tend toward the precious, they're often balanced here by sheer dramatic power and telling insights ("Isn't It Romantic" fairly bristles with ironic chauvinism) and a few loopy curves ("The Mole People," the Sherman Brothers' "The Ugly Bug Ball," and the previously unreleased "Rhode Island Is Famous for You"). Feinstein's dedicated song archaeology is also showcased on several gems: "Violin," a duet with Liza Minnelli; "My Favorite Year," a rejected ballad for the film of that name; the sublime "lost" Gershwin classic "Ask Me Again."
Sprinkled with live performances (the forum where Feinstein's talents seem most energized) and studio outtakes and featuring a lengthy print interview with the singer, the set chronicles both the pioneering efforts of one of pop music's most successful revivalists and, crucially, the cream of his beloved American songwriters, from stalwarts Gershwin, Berlin, and Porter to later legends like Herman, Styne, Lane, Martin, and Mercer. --Jerry McCulley
